Development of a Reliable Extreme Pressure (EP) Screening Test for Tractor Lubes 680607
The need has long existed for a reliable bench test to measure the load carrying properties of multipurpose power transmission fluids for tractors. This paper describes one that meets this need. The test utilizes an SAE Load Machine, modified for oil recirculation and temperature control, and runs under low speed, high torque conditions that simulate final drive operation of tractors. It was used to predict performance of several experimental multipurpose power transmission fluids in actual tractor gear tests, and a good correlation was found. The data provided demonstrate that this test is a valuable tool in formulating improved multipurpose power transmission fluids.
